In today's game, the other team is going to complete some passes - no matter who you're playing. I thought for the most part, the Gopher DB's did a good job of containing receivers after the catch and limiting big plays. if the other team can make enough plays to drive 70 or 80 yards for a score, then hats off to them - they did their job. Playing DB is a thankless job - every mistake is out there for everyone to see. If a lineman misses a block, or a WR runs the wrong route, we might not see it or realize what happened. But when a DB blows a coverage, it's usually a big play or TD for the opponents.
